If you are talking about Barba try in the second half in the corner Barba turns it into a footrace and there aren't too many players who could of stopped him in the NRL let alone Sirro

Sironen was having to keep him on the outside to stop him stepping inside him as there was no inside defence working back inside
In wet slippery conditions you always try and make the opposition throw the extra pass
He did the best thing possible , which was to make the conversion harder

Hellman tell me how he could of handled it any other way He is marking a guy who is much quicker and much more nimbler who had him beat on the outside and was defending in the centres against a guy over ten metres is one of the quickest going around

If anything the winger should of come in nailed Barba and then let Sirro try and drill the winger into touch if they go outside Barba
